In El Segundo, a professionally installed and monitored security system typically ranges from $600 to $1,500 for equipment and installation, plus a monthly monitoring fee of $30 to $60. Local factors that can influence cost include the need for seismic-rated mounting for alarm components due to earthquake risk, and the prevalence of stucco construction which can require specialized drilling techniques. Prices may also be slightly higher than national averages due to the higher cost of living and business operations in the South Bay area.
Your system should be chosen with both noise and climate in mind. For homes under flight paths, we recommend systems with advanced audio analytics to reduce false alarms from constant low-flying aircraft noise. The coastal salt air can accelerate corrosion on outdoor cameras and sensors, so it's crucial to select equipment with weatherproof (IP66 or higher) and corrosion-resistant ratings, and to ensure they are installed in sheltered positions where possible.
Yes, El Segundo requires an alarm permit from the El Segundo Police Department. You must apply for and renew this permit annually for a fee; operating an alarm system without a valid permit can result in fines. Furthermore, California state law (CA Penal Code 13730) mandates that all monitored alarm systems be registered with your local law enforcement agency, and there are strict guidelines on fines for excessive false alarms, which the city actively enforces.

While the mild weather makes video doorbells reliable year-round, a full system is strongly recommended. El Segundo's low rainfall and frequent sunny days are ideal for outdoor cameras, but a comprehensive approach is best. A full system includes door/window sensors, motion detectors, and glass-break sensors to protect against common local entry methods. This layered defense is critical, as property crimes of opportunity can occur even in low-crime areas, especially with easy freeway access like the 105 and 405 nearby.
